Help for this page

Select Code to Download


  1. or download this
    open(FH, "wrongs") or die $!;
    open(FH2, ">wrongs2") or die $!;
    ...
    }
    close (FH);
    close (FH2);
    
  2. or download this
    perl -lpe 's/wrongs/wrongs3/' wrongs >wrongs2
    
  3. or download this
    perl -lpi -e 's/wrongs/wrongs3/' wrongs
    
  4. or download this
    perl -lpe "s/wrongs/wrongs3/" wrongs >wrongs2
    
  5. or download this
    perl -lpi.bak -e "s/wrongs/wrongs3/" wrongs
    
  6. or download this
    perl -lpi '$c++ if s/wrongs/wrongs3/; END{warn "count=$c\n"}' wrongs
    
  7. or download this
    $ time perl -lpe '$c++ if s/sex/cool/; END{warn "count=$c\n"}' gse1.lo
    +g >/dev/null 
    count=2840
    ...
    real    0m19.062s
    user    0m16.736s
    sys     0m0.940s
    
  8. or download this
    perl -lpi '$c+=s/wrongs/wrongs3/g; END{warn "count=$c\n"}' wrongs
    
  9. or download this
    perl -lpi 's/wrongs($c++)/wrongs3/g; END{warn "count=$c\n"}' wrongs